可通过调整Window: Zoom Level整体缩放界面,或使用自定义CSS修改活动栏与状态栏字体图标大小,推荐优先使用缩放功能以确保兼容性。

VSCode 的活动栏(侧边栏图标)和状态栏的字体与图标大小不能直接通过设置项独立调整,但可以通过修改整体缩放比例或使用自定义 CSS 的方式间接实现。以下是几种可行的方法:
1. 使用窗口缩放(推荐,安全)
VSCode 提供了全局缩放功能,可以等比放大包括活动栏、状态栏在内的整个界面。
操作方法:- 打开设置(Ctrl + , 或 Cmd + ,)
- 搜索 zoom
- 找到 Window: Zoom Level
- 调整数值:默认为 0,增大(如 1、2)会整体放大,减小(如 -1)则缩小
这个设置会影响编辑器所有 UI 元素,包括菜单、侧边栏图标、状态栏文字等,是最简单且兼容性最好的方式。
2. 修改字体大小(仅限状态栏文字)
如果你只想调大状态栏的文字部分,可以通过设置编辑器字体来间接影响部分文本显示(但状态栏本身不支持单独设置字体大小)。
- VSCode 目前没有官方选项用于单独设置状态栏或活动栏图标的字体大小
- 某些扩展(如自定义主题)可能会提供有限样式控制
3. 高级方法:自定义 CSS(不推荐新手)
通过修改 VSCode 的样式文件,可以手动调整图标和文字大小,但此方法需要谨慎操作,更新后可能失效。
示例步骤(以 Windows 为例):- 找到 VSCode 安装目录下的 resources\app\out\vs\workbench 中的 CSS 文件(如 workbench.html 引用的样式)
- 或使用第三方工具(如
vscode-custom-css插件)注入自定义样式 - 添加类似以下 CSS:
.monaco-workbench .activitybar .icon { zoom: 1.2; }
.monaco-workbench .statusbar .item { font-size: 14px; }
警告:此方法违反 VSCode 使用条款风险较低但可能导致界面异常,建议备份并了解后果。
总结
最稳妥的方式是使用 Window: Zoom Level 调整整体界面大小。若仅需稍作优化,可尝试更换高对比度或大字体主题。直接修改字体和图标大小受限于当前 VSCode 的设计,原生不支持细粒度控制。
基本上就这些常用方法。










